Inquisitor Jacob Sprenger banned Kramer from preaching, and definitely didn't get the job done with Kramer nor function a co-author of the e-book; the Bishop of Brixen, George Golser, shut down Kramer's tried demo at Innsbruck and then expelled him from the city even though describing him as senile; the alleged Papal decree A part of the reserve has long been viewed by historians being a forgery considering the fact that no such Papal decree really exists; the college for the College of Cologne condemned the "Malleus Maleficarum" as unlawful and heretical instead of supporting it, major the Church to ban the ebook a few decades after publication; and so on). On the wider issues of witch searching: the "8 million executions" determine is usually a variation with the discredited "9 million" determine that has been traced to an 18th century author who just extrapolated Witchcraft making use of arbitrary math. The figure approved by modern-day historians is about forty,000 to fifty,000 from 1450 to 1750 (the period when the vast majority of these prosecutions occurred). Most witchcraft prosecutions have been completed by secular courts for a similar motive historic Roman (pagan) regulation had also banned the use of black magic (viewed as a crime, not a religious issue), as did most other legislation codes through heritage. In medieval Christian Europe it had been likewise usually prosecuted only if folks imagined the alleged witch was employing it for hazardous uses, and for this reason was prosecuted very like another criminal offense apart from with witchcraft staying considered given that the "weapon" or method. The medieval Catholic Church's standard view (at least for the majority of the clergy) was that witchcraft was a superstition, not a rival religion.
